Output b623091789d6fe7e076b7d3e2cd40b16e0cf8177c6783c5bc2fa3676bbbb9797:13

value
101568370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0d28c51839fbefe77a806e3b6a6b8b8b7d9827b OP_EQUAL
address
3LjAhaqeFvQ81dBTbRkp5Rqr9urrRv95A2
transaction
b623091789d6fe7e076b7d3e2cd40b16e0cf8177c6783c5bc2fa3676bbbb9797
spent
true